How to increase wifi speed (130 mbs fed to router but 39 mbs max wifi )

Hello,

 

I have upgraded my Internet provider to a 120 mbs feed into my home. I am actually getting 130 mbs at the RBR50 Orbi router. However, the wifi speed in my home reaches only 39 mbs. How can I make it faster?

 

I have one router (RBR50, firmware version V2.3.5.30) and one satellite (RBS50, firmware version V2.3.4.30)

Re: How to increase wifi speed (130 mbs fed to router but 39 mbs max wifi )

Be sure both RBR and RBS are using same version of FW.

https://kb.netgear.com/000037217/How-do-I-check-and-manually-upgrade-the-firmware-on-my-Orbi-satelli...

 

What wireless devices are you using to speed test with? Be sure the device is connected to the RBR or RBS for testing. Turn OFF the RBS temporarily.

What is the Mfr and model# of the Internet Service Providers modem/ONT the NG router is connected too?

 

What is the size of your home? Sq Ft?
What is the distance between the router and satellite(s)? 30 feet or more is recommended in between RBR and RBS to begin with depending upon building materials when wirelessly connected.
https://kb.netgear.com/31029/Where-should-I-place-my-Orbi-satellite

 

What channels are you using? Auto? Try setting manual channel 1, 6 or 11 on 2.4Ghz and 40 to 48 channel on 5Ghz.
Any Wifi Neighbors near by? If so, how many?

 

Try enabling Beamforming and MIMO(MIMO may or may not be needed) and WMM. Under Advanced Tab/Advanced Settings/Wireless Settings

Re: How to increase wifi speed (130 mbs fed to router but 39 mbs max wifi )

Same version of firmware are used on bothe router and satellite (V2.3.5.30)

 

Modem mfr is Hitron; model CODA-4680

 

Home is 2000 sq ft ,on two story. (1500 + 500). router and satellite are on 1500 sq ft story and 30 ft appart.

 

Setting modifications and resulting download speed:

Enabled Beamforming

Enabeld MU-MIMO

changed 2.4 GHz from auto to 01: result 37 Mbs download speed

changed 2.4 GHz from 01 to 06: result 24 Mbs download speed

changed 2.4 GHz from 06 to 11: result 28 Mbs download speed

changed 2.4 GHz from 11 back to auto : result 43 Mbs download speed

 

I live downtown and there are 5 other wifi network with visible SSID and within range.

 

So the fastest wifi I can obtain is with 2.4 GHz set to auto. When I first posted this, I had 39 Mbs download speed. The only other change was the Enabled Beamforming and MU-MIMO.

 

Still, 43 Mbs fom an Orbi which can apparently deliver in the 100's Mbs wifi speed is deceiving. Again, my internet feed to the router is 130 Mbs ! Orbi can only pull 43 Mbs out of the 130 Mbs potential. Deceiving.

 

Any faster router out there?

 

Orbi was advertised as rocket speed wifi. It is not performing to that level in my book,

What wireless devices are you using to speed test with? Is it connecting at 2.4Ghz or 5Ghz? 

 

Your ISP modem already has a built in router and wifi:

https://us.hitrontech.com/products/service-providers/coda-4680-cable-modem-router/

This would be a double NAT (two router) condition which isn't recommended. https://kb.netgear.com/30186/What-is-Double-NAT
https://kb.netgear.com/30187/How-to-fix-issues-with-Double-NAT
Couple of options,
1. Configure the modem for transparent bridge or modem only mode. Then use the Orbi router in router mode. You'll need to contact the ISP for help and information in regards to the modem being bridged correctly.
2. If you can't bridge the modem, disable ALL wifi radios on the modem, configure the modems DMZ/ExposedHost or IP Pass-Through for the IP address the Orbi router gets from the modem. Then you can use the Orbi router in Router mode.
3. Or disable all wifi radios on the modem and connect the Orbi router to the modem, configure AP mode on the Orbi router. https://kb.netgear.com/31218/How-do-I-configure-my-Orbi-router-to-act-as-an-access-point and https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=H7LOcJ8GdDo&app=desktop

I did bridge the modem. That was the first thing that I did. 

The Orbi router is connected to it with a Ethernet cable and there is only the Orbi wifi network available for my use.

 

I did all my test with my ipod, on 2.4 GHz.

The iPod will be limited in this wifi design and support. I presume it maybe where your problem is. 

I recommend testing with a different device, like a phone, pad, laptop or PC with wireless capabilities to compare speed results.

I checked with a 5 yr old ipad an obtained 45 mbs.

But then I checked with my laptop and got 128 mbs !!

So it is the output device (ipod, ipad, laptop) that throttles the wifi speed and not the router / satelite combination.Interesting.

iPods are not know for there wifi performances. Pads have better wifi, depends on there design and support. To ensure your seeing good speeds on wifi, always check with a laptop or phone or something that has a good wifi design.
